Aaron Kampman In Jacksonville
While the Bears and Lions did their best to get free agency off to a fast start, LB Aaron Kampman wasn't the first priority for either team, the Bears went for DE Julius Peppers and the Lions for DE Kyle Vanden Bosch, so now Kampman is making the rounds. He was in Jacksonville on Saturday according to Jacksonville.com:
At 30, Kampman appears to be in the prime of his career. He'd be a welcome addition to the Jags, which are coming off a disappointing season in which they produced a league-low 14 sacks.
It doesn't feel like Kampman's in the prime of his career. Maybe I'm just accustomed to the recent Packer teams with an average age around 26 years old. Though River City Rage at Big Cat Country described Kampman as "older" and concluded his signing would be questionable.
Jacksonville.com has a nice roundup of all the recent Kampman rumors:
Kampman had been rumored to be drawing interest from Tampa Bay, Philadelphia and Seattle. But by coaxing Kampman to take his first free agent visit to Jacksonville, the Jags may have increased their chances of landing him. Kampman’s representatives remain in contact with Philadelphia, but it’s unclear whether he plans to visit the Eagles or any of the other teams that have expressed interest.
